United States Seize Command in Group D with Confident Win over Australia
Dominant US display in Seattle sees them tighten grip on World Cup progression.
Quick summary
The United States produced an assured 2-0 victory over Australia in Seattle, continuing their strong start to the World Cup and moving closer to a place in the knockout rounds. Mauricio Pochettino’s side controlled the tempo and showcased their attacking quality, delighting a passionate home crowd.
With a raucous crowd behind them in Seattle, the United States continued their impressive World Cup campaign by defeating Australia 2-0 in Group D. This result, coming hot on the heels of their opening 4-1 win over Paraguay, puts the Americans firmly atop their group and within touching distance of the knockout phase.
Manager Mauricio Pochettino set up his side to press aggressively from the outset, and it paid immediate dividends. The US dictated possession, stifling Australian build-up and launching frequent attacks down both flanks. The Australians, fresh from their own opening victory against Turkey, struggled to keep pace with the hosts’ energy and tactical discipline.
